In the rapidly evolving world of robotics and autonomous systems, perception and navigation remain at the core of intelligent operation. The Odin1 Spatial Memory Module represents a breakthrough in this field—integrating advanced multi-sensor hardware with powerful SLAM algorithms to enable machines not only to perceive their environment, but also to understand, remember, and navigate it with human-like spatial awareness.
At the heart of Odin1 lies a deeply integrated system combining high-performance sensing hardware with the proprietary MindSLAM™ fusion algorithm. This powerful combination allows robots and UAVs to achieve real-time 3D perception, precise localization, and persistent spatial memory.
Unlike traditional perception systems that rely solely on cameras or LiDAR, Odin1 fuses multiple data streams—including depth sensing, RGB imaging, and inertial measurements—into a unified spatial understanding. The result is a system capable of building accurate maps, tracking motion, and adapting to dynamic environments with exceptional reliability.
Odin1 delivers high-fidelity environmental awareness through its cutting-edge sensing technology. With long-range depth detection of up to 70 meters and a wide field of view of 120° × 90°, the module captures rich spatial data across diverse environments.
Its ability to generate dense point clouds—up to 700,000 points per second—enables detailed 3D reconstruction and accurate obstacle detection. Combined with a high-resolution global shutter RGB camera, Odin1 ensures clear and precise data capture even in challenging conditions such as low light or reflective surfaces.
This level of perception allows robots to operate with confidence in complex, real-world scenarios—from indoor navigation to large-scale outdoor mapping.
One of Odin1’s most defining features is its ability to provide persistent spatial memory, allowing machines to “remember” their surroundings over time. Powered by the MindSLAM™ algorithm, the module achieves centimeter-level positioning accuracy (±5 cm) and ultra-fast pose updates of up to 1000 Hz.
This capability transforms how robots navigate. Instead of reacting passively to their environment, they can build continuous spatial models, recognize previously visited locations, and optimize their paths intelligently.
Additionally, Odin1 performs robustly in environments where traditional systems struggle—such as low-light areas, reflective surfaces like glass, or even water scenes—ensuring reliable operation across a wide range of applications.
Designed with efficiency in mind, Odin1 offloads heavy computation from the host system by directly outputting trajectories and mapping results. This significantly reduces onboard processing requirements, allowing robotic platforms to focus their computational resources on higher-level tasks such as motion control and decision-making.
With seamless integration support—including USB connectivity, ROS compatibility, and full SDK access—developers can easily incorporate Odin1 into existing robotic systems, accelerating development cycles and reducing complexity.
